Hurricane Narda intensifies, winds reach 85 mph
Hurricane Narda has intensified into a hurricane as of Tuesday morning, with sustained winds reaching nearly 85 mph. The storm is currently located approximately 295 miles southwest of Manzanillo, Mexico, and is moving westward at a speed of 13 mph. Forecasters predict that Narda will maintain its current trajectory over the next few days.
